Set a few blocks from the waterfront this welcoming hotel has been thoughtfully restored.
This beautifully refurbished 1950s hotel has a rich history and has welcomed plenty of colourful characters through its doors and into its old clubs and casinos. Today, it’s a modern and comfortable base behind its rather austere façade, and it features a variety of restaurants and bars as well as welcoming its guests with friendly service. From the popular rooftop swimming pool you can enjoy fantastic views over the capital and the Caribbean Sea can be glimpsed in the distance.
Each morning, a freshly prepared buffet is available allowing you to fuel up before a long day of sightseeing. If you want to return to the hotel for lunch, or you’re looking to dine in one night, the 19th-floor Italian restaurant La Florentina is an ideal choice. The restaurant where breakfast is served each morning is also open for lunch and dinner and you’ll have the choice of buffet dishes or a set menu. Drinks can be enjoyed at the lobby bar or by the rooftop pool.
By Cuban standards, the rooms are very modern and you can choose between the simple Standard Rooms, slightly more spacious Superior Rooms or the Junior Suites which have a small seating area. Suites are also available.
